How to compare peptide suppliers: start with batch evidence
A Certificate of Analysis, or COA, is one of the clearest indicators of a supplier’s quality-control approach. It should relate to the specific product batch being supplied, not simply be a generic document for a compound name.
Check that the COA identifies the compound, batch or lot number, test date and reported purity. These details should correspond with the product labelling wherever possible. A document with no identifiable batch reference cannot provide meaningful reassurance that it relates to the material you are purchasing.
Purity results matter, but context matters too. A claim of 99%+ purity is more credible when it is supported by batch-level analytical reporting and a stated method. Suppliers should be able to demonstrate that they treat testing as part of the supply process, not as a marketing extra.
Look at the analytical method, not only the percentage
High-performance liquid chromatography, commonly shown as HPLC, is widely used to assess peptide purity. It can provide a useful indication of the proportion of the desired compound within a sample. However, an HPLC percentage on its own does not fully establish identity.
Identity testing, such as mass spectrometry, adds another layer of confidence by helping confirm that the molecular mass aligns with the stated peptide. Where a supplier provides both purity and identity information, the quality picture is more complete.
You do not need to be an analytical chemist to compare documents effectively. Look for clear results, named testing methods and information that is specific to the batch. Be cautious where reports are cropped, undated, difficult to read or reused across multiple products without clear traceability.
Assess whether the product presentation matches the compound
The peptide itself is only part of the decision. Product presentation should be clear, consistent and appropriate for laboratory research use. Labels should identify the compound, stated quantity, batch reference and storage guidance. Ambiguous labelling creates uncertainty before any analysis begins.
For lyophilised peptides supplied in vials, buyers should be able to establish the stated amount of material and whether the product is presented as a single compound or as part of a blend. This is especially relevant when comparing products with similar names, different strengths or alternative salt forms.
Products such as BPC-157, GHK-Cu and MOTS-C may appear straightforward to compare, yet product listings can differ significantly in stated quantity, documentation and storage requirements. A lower price per vial is not automatically better value if the batch evidence, declared content or handling standards are unclear.
Peptide pens require an additional level of scrutiny. A pre-filled format should have precise product identification, clear strength information and dependable packaging. Buyers comparing research peptide pens, including retatrutide or tirzepatide formats, should focus on documentation and presentation rather than treating convenience as a substitute for quality assurance.
Separate sourcing claims from verifiable controls
Terms such as “lab tested”, “research grade” and “high purity” can be useful when they are backed by evidence. Used without documentation, they are simply claims. The difference between a dependable supplier and an unverified seller is often found in how openly they communicate their controls.
Consider whether the supplier explains its testing standard, makes COAs available and maintains a focused catalogue it can reasonably support. A specialist supplier with clear information on a selected range can be easier to assess than a broad marketplace offering hundreds of unrelated compounds with inconsistent product data.
Consistency is another useful measure. Compare several listings, not just the product you intend to purchase. Are batch details, testing information and product descriptions presented to the same standard across the range? A single well-produced page may look convincing, but repeatable quality signals across the catalogue carry more weight.
It is also sensible to assess how the supplier handles questions. Clear, factual responses about documentation, batch references and dispatch procedures suggest an organised operation. Evasive replies, pressure to buy quickly or vague assurances should prompt caution.
Compare price on a like-for-like basis
Price is relevant, but it should sit at the end of the comparison process rather than the beginning. Two suppliers may list the same peptide at very different prices because the products are not directly equivalent in stated quantity, batch testing, packaging or delivery service.
First compare the declared amount of compound. Then compare the available batch evidence and product format. Finally, account for delivery costs and expected dispatch times. This gives a more accurate view of value than a headline price alone.
Exceptionally cheap material can be a warning sign when there is no transparent explanation of testing or provenance. Equally, a premium price is not proof of premium control. The goal is not to find the most expensive supplier. It is to find a supplier whose price is supported by clear, relevant quality information.
Do not overlook storage, packaging and fulfilment
Even well-characterised material can be compromised by poor handling. Peptide suppliers should provide practical storage guidance and package products in a way that supports safe transit. The appropriate approach depends on the compound and format, so generic promises about packaging are less useful than clear product-specific information.
For UK buyers, fulfilment reliability can make a material difference. Confirm where orders are dispatched from, whether tracking is provided and what the normal dispatch window is. A supplier that holds stock locally and offers tracked delivery reduces uncertainty around delivery timing compared with a seller relying on unpredictable international shipping routes.
Discreet, secure packaging and accurate order processing also matter. These are operational details, but they indicate whether a supplier has built processes around reliability. Delayed dispatches, unclear tracking or frequent stock discrepancies create unnecessary risk for time-sensitive research purchasing.
Check policies before placing a larger order
Before committing to a larger purchase, review the supplier’s contact details, dispatch information and policies for damaged, incorrect or missing orders. The wording should be specific enough to tell you what happens if a problem arises.
It can be sensible to begin with a smaller order when assessing a new supplier. This gives you an opportunity to review the product presentation, batch documentation, delivery speed and customer service directly. It is a practical way to test consistency without relying solely on website copy.
Keep the research-use boundary clear
Responsible peptide suppliers communicate the intended research status of their materials clearly. Research compounds should be described and handled as laboratory-use materials, not promoted with unsupported therapeutic promises or personal-use instructions.
This distinction is a useful quality signal in itself. Suppliers that rely on medical-style claims while providing limited analytical evidence are placing marketing ahead of disciplined product communication. Clear research-use positioning, combined with transparent testing and traceable batches, is the stronger standard.
